The IPP Trophy is a tennis tournament held in Geneva, Switzerland since 1988. The event is part of the ATP challenger series and is played on outdoor clay courts. Two-time Swiss champion Stanislas Wawrinka would later enter the world top 10 in the ATP rankings in 2008.
